A tool designed to estimate the amount of wine required for a gathering, considering factors such as the number of attendees, the duration of the event, and the drinking habits of the guests is essential for event planning. For example, such a tool might calculate that a four-hour event with 50 guests who moderately enjoy wine will necessitate the purchase of 15 bottles.
The significance of such a calculation lies in its ability to minimize waste and ensure an adequate supply of beverages. Accurate estimations prevent running out of wine during an event, averting potential dissatisfaction among attendees. Historically, hosts relied on intuition and past experiences, leading to frequent miscalculations; modern tools offer a more precise and data-driven approach.
